It comes loaded with code generators, an extensive code library, the ability to … WebSet WDApp = CreateObject ("word.Application") Above code is used to create a new object of the word application. Word application will start running, but by default, it will not be visible. WDApp.Visible = True Above code is used to make the word application window visible. WebJun 22, 2024 · Add the code to Excel VBA and amend Let’s head back to the Excel VBA Editor and use the Early Binding method to control to Microsoft Word. In the Visual Basic Editor click Tools -> References select Microsoft Word x.xx Object Library. Then click OK. As we are using Early Binding we need to declare the Application as a variable as follows:
